Hundreds of junior students competed at Binh Thuan 22nd Young Informatics Competition

27/04/2021, 15:40

BTO – As many as 213 Young students from 10 districts, townlet and city partook in the online short-list round of the Binh Thuan 22nd Junior Informatics Competition. The event, which took place on April 25th, is held by the coordination of the HCYU of Binh Thuan province, the Departments of Education and Training, Science and Technology, Information and Communication, Finance, and the Binh Thuan TV and Radio station.

After the first round, 183 students from selection teams and 30 students with the highest scores have been short-listed by the Jury. Those students are divided into 3 tables of A, B, C, and creative software competition with 81, 81, 51, and 10 contestants, respectively. 10 students who took part in the Software Creation competition had to represent their works before the examiner board.

After 1 earnest day of competition, the top positions of Table A, B, and C called the names of primary student Huynh Ngoc Phu Quy (Tuyen Quang primary school – Phan Thiet city),; Student Kieu Quang Huy (Hung Vuong secondary school), and student Mai Nhu Anh Khoa (Tran Hung Dao gifted high school) respectively. With respect to the Software Creation competition, students of Tanh Linh high school Hoang Kim Long outstandingly gained second prize (without first prize).

Overall, the Phan Thiet City team was wholly placed first position in this competition.

The Binh Thuan Young Informatics Competition, which is an annual activity, aims to select excellent students and teams to participate in the 27th National Young Informatics Competition.

In this year’s contest, the Jury has detected and cultivated 682 talented students, promoting the information activities and study among teenagers and adolescents, improving the province’s junior human resources.
